Team News
AC Milan
AC Carpi
- Cristian Brocchi will not be able to field the same XI that won the game in Genova since Juraj Kucka is suspended. Andrea Bertolacci and Luiz Adriano has been ruled out for the reception of Carpi.
- Mario Balotelli seems safe to retain his place after two good performances. Kevin-Prince Boateng was reportedly tested in the role behind the two strikers in training and he could start there on Thursday, with Jack Bonaventure dropping into midfield in Bertolacci's absence.
- Fabrizio Castori will have the same problem as his counterpart, not being able to field the same last XI because of one absentee.
- Riccardo Gagliolo, who is suspended, will leave his spot to Emanuele Suagher.
